A Life Among Monkeys

About the Show

Learn the extraordinary story of Dr Wolfgang Dittus, a young scientist who, in 1968, went to study Toque macaques in Sri Lanka for 18 months. Captivated by the character, charm and audacity of these monkeys, little did he know that he had embarked upon a journey that would last a lifetime. Over half a century, in the world's longest continuous monkey study, he has charted the lives of over 5,000 individual monkeys – mapping their births, deaths, relationships, changes in rank and shifting allegiances.
